Ah yes, the classic controller is a must if you plan on playing SNES games via Virtual Console. Especially if you want to play the Donkey Kong Country games, the Gamecube controller is horrible. I don't think you can play SNES games with the Wii remote either.

Fire Emblem: Radiant Dawn isn't bad at all. It's actually kind of easy for a Fire Emblem game (relatively), which makes it way better for someone unfamiliar with the series. Neither Roy nor Marth are in it, but Ike from Brawl is (although he looks a lot cooler in RD than in Brawl).

 

 

 

Roy's game has never been made in America. Marth's is being made now for the DS but you won't see it for a while either.
